Greeting Card Campaign for First Responders, Healthcare Workers

The Neptune Recreation Department is hosting a new greeting card campaign designed to bring a little cheer to  frontline workers. Families in Neptune Township are encouraged to create homemade cards to help lift the spirits of nurses, doctors, EMT workers, policemen, firefighters and other first responders as they work through the Covid-19 pandemic.

Parents are asked to place the cards in the box at the entrance door to the Neptune Township Municipal Building located at 25 Neptune Blvd. (no envelopes needed). The Recreation Department will then deliver the cards to the hospital and/or first responders.
